Tough fixture for Academy's Year 7 footballers

On 19th January 2015, Dartmouth Academy played against Kingsbridge CC in the first round of the Devon Cup. This was the Year 7's first fixture since their successful performance at the Devon 5-a-side Festival. Their lack of form told in the first 5 minutes, conceded 3 goals in quick succession. After a swift change in formation, Dartmouth looked much stronger and were finally playing some football in the KCC half. Ben Clark showed a change of pace down the right wing and laid it off nicely to Jordan Caple, who nestled the ball into the roof of the net to make it 3-1. After half time, Dartmouth conceded again. This time the shot was deflected away from Liam Harrison, who had previously made some excellent saves. Dartmouth then attacked, as Caleb Hobson escaped his marker only to be fouled on the edge of the area. Jordan Caple stepped up to take the free kick and drilled it into the bottom right corner to make it 4-2. Unfortunately, Dartmouth ended the way they began, conceded 3 goals to leave the score at 7-2. Man of the Match went to Caleb Hobson. There is certainly room for improvement from this team but the potential is there. Re-match against Kingsbridge CC will hopefully see an improved result!
